Towing With Tow Bar. Tow bars are usually less expensive to purchase than a dolly or flatbed. Yes, you can put a tow bar on any car as long as it is suitable for towing and has the necessary mounting points. Flat towing involves a tow bar, a tool that has several advantages to other types of towing. By distributing the towing force evenly and maintaining proper alignment, the tow bar facilitates smooth and controlled towing operations. The tow bar works by providing a secure and stable connection between the two cars, allowing the towing vehicle to pull the towed vehicle safely. Adding a tow bar allows you to tow trailers, caravans, or other vehicles with your car, providing additional versatility and functionality. It comes with a base plate where the towed vehicle is placed. A tow bar is a flat towing equipment that can be mounted to the vehicle you’re towing. A tow bar for a car is also referred to as a “four down.”
